Aside from football, most youth sports leagues do not require children to wear mouthguards . Unfortunately, almost every activity can turn physical, and kids often get hurt as a result. Fortunately, you can utilize protective equipment to keep your children safe and happy with their choice of sport. Here is how. Why Your Children Need Them Most parents choose to have their children play some type of sport. Depending on which they go with, their children might be at risk of impact to the head. While this outcome should not scare you away from enrolling your kids in activities, you should do everything you can to keep them as safe as possible when at play. One of the best ways to do so is having them wear a mouthguard. The following are a few dangers that this piece of protective equipment can help defend against.
